A tap leaks at the rate of 2cm³ per second.How long will it take the tap to fill a container of 45litres capacity.
Answer:
6 hours 15 minutes
Step-by-step explanation:
1 litre = 1000cm³
45 litres = 45000cm³
Volume = rate × time
45000 = 2 × t
t = 22500 secs
= 375 mins

Work Shown:
1 liter = 1000 cubic cm
45 liters = 45*1000 = 45000 cubic cm
The container has a capacity of 45000 cubic cm
It will take 45000/2 = 22500 seconds to fill the container since the rate is 2 cubic cm per second.
-----------------
Convert from seconds to minutes
22500 seconds = (22500)*(1 min/60 sec)
22500 seconds = (22500/60) min
22500 seconds = 375 min
-----------------
Convert to hours
375 min = (375)*(1 hr/60 min)
375 min = (375/60) hr
375 min = 6.25 hr
----------------
Converting to hours,minutes
6.25 hr = 6 hr + 0.25 hr
6.25 hr = 6 hr + (0.25*60) min
6.25 hr = 6 hr + 15 min
6.25 hr = 6 hr, 15 min

A small class has 9 students, 4 of whine are girls and 5 of whom are boys. Teacher is going to choose two of the students at random. What is the probability that the teacher will choose two girls? Write your answer as a fraction in simplest form.
The probability that the teacher will choose two girls would be = 1/6
What is probability?Probability is defined as the expression that shows the possibility of an outcome of an event which may or may not happen.
The total number of students in the class = 9
The total number of girls = 4
The total number of boys = 5
The formula for finding probability = No of favourable outcome/Total number of outcomes.
The probability that teacher choose first girl = 4/9
One girl is selected we must reduce the number of girls available for selection to 4 - 1 = 3.
We must also reduce the number of children available for selection 9 - 1 = 8.
The probability that teacher choose second girl = 3/8
Thus, the probability = 4/9 × 3/8 = 1/6

The following table shows parts of the result of the javelin throw finals at the olympics 2020 (Tokyo).(a) Compute the (arithmetic) mean of the distances. (b) Compute the variance of the distances.
So first we need to find the mean of this set. This value is given by adding all the elements in the set and dividing that result by the total number of elements. In this case it would be the sum of all the distance divided by 8 since there are 8 different distances:
\(\frac{87.58+86.67+\cdots+83.30+83.28}{8}=84.9875\)So the mean is 84.9875 and that's the answer to part a.
In part b we must calculate the variance. This value is given by the sum of the square deviations divided by the total number of elements. The square deviations (S) are the squares of the difference between each element and the mean:
\(S=(x-\mu)^2\)Where S is the square deviation, x the value of the element and the greek letter μ is the mean. In this case x would be each distance and μ=84.9875. So the square deviations are given by:
\(S=(x-84.9875)^2\)We need to calculate this quantity for each of the 8 distances. Then we add the 8 results and we divide them by 8. This way we find the variance. In the following table you can see the distances, the square deviation of each and the values of the mean and the variance:
Then, the answer to part a is 84.9875 and to part b is 2.1731.
